Understanding Bean to Cup Machines
Before diving into the very best coffee beans, it's crucial to understand how bean-to-cup machines run. These machines grind whole coffee beans, brew them, and serve coffee immediately, guaranteeing maximum freshness and taste. The type of beans used can greatly affect the outcome, making the choice of beans crucial for coffee enthusiasts searching for a quality cup.

What is the best roast level for bean-to-cup coffee?
The best roast level largely depends upon individual taste. Light roasts keep more of the original bean flavor while dark roasts have a stronger, bolder taste. Medium roasts provide a balance of both.
2. How typically should I alter the coffee beans in my machine?
For the best coffee beans for bean to cup uk flavor, it's recommended to use beans within 2-3 weeks of roasting. After that, they may lose freshness and taste.
3. How can I tell if the coffee beans are fresh?
Look for a roast date on the product packaging. Freshly roasted beans will have a visible scent and must not taste stale.
4. Can I use pre-ground coffee in a bean-to-cup machine?
Preferably, bean-to-cup machines are created to deal with whole beans for optimum freshness. Pre-ground coffee may result in inconsistent outcomes.
5. What storage techniques are best for coffee beans?
Store coffee beans in an airtight container away from light, heat, and wetness to maintain their freshness for as long as possible.
